Transaction 397933e51d70f948fa610d3bc9941f4b838d33f9517fdc36e959ea126a8cf45c
1 Input
2 Outputs
- 397933e51d70f948fa610d3bc9941f4b838d33f9517fdc36e959ea126a8cf45c:0
- 397933e51d70f948fa610d3bc9941f4b838d33f9517fdc36e959ea126a8cf45c:1
value 129360
address 173EVpkQtZVsRuxgoUjNnptddW7bn8Qi5e
value 423103
address 34LxvX15nrj1TW9pnsPC1uLPewoEb6dYrF